And the most important thing you can do on your own to keep your home pest-free is to eliminate any potential habitat or food sources. You should mow your lawn at least once a month during the winter months, and rake up leaves and pine needles that accumulate near your home. Termites and other pests also love to snack on leftover pet food, so be sure to pick up pet food dishes after your outdoor pets have eaten.

Termites are particularly fond of moist, unpainted wood, so be sure to replace and repaint any rotten or water-damaged wood on your home’s exterior surfaces as soon as you notice the damage. Be sure to also keep your rain gutters clear of leaves and other debris, and add some gravel to any areas where rainwater accumulates. And if you ever spot “mud tubes” spiderwebbing along your home’s exterior, be sure to contact us right away for a follow-up visit.
